How they compare
Faroe Islands currently reports 7,187 1000 USD against 7,093 1000 USD in Brunei Darussalam, a difference of 94 1000 USD.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Brunei Darussalam ahead.
Brunei Darussalam ranks 146th and Faroe Islands ranks 145th of 210 countries.
Brunei Darussalam has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Brunei Darussalam | Faroe Islands |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 7,797 1000 USD | 2,707 1000 USD | 5,090 1000 USD | Brunei Darussalam |
| 2010s | 9,442 1000 USD | 2,492 1000 USD | 6,950 1000 USD | Brunei Darussalam |
| 2020s | 7,960 1000 USD | 4,420 1000 USD | 3,540 1000 USD | Brunei Darussalam |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
